Zmiana prędkości cięcia

Dyskusje dotyczące programowania G-Code

Autor tematu
modrzej
Nowy użytkownik, używaj wyszukiwarki
Nowy użytkownik, używaj wyszukiwarki
Posty w temacie: 3
Posty: 3
Rejestracja: 30 mar 2011, 22:51
Lokalizacja: łódź

Zmiana prędkości cięcia

#1

Post napisał: modrzej » 30 mar 2011, 23:01

Potrzebuję wskazówki, czy zmiana prędkości cięcia może następować przez wywołanie makra i czy ta prędkość będzie utrzymywana aż do kolejnej zmiany?

Tak mi się widzi wykorzystanie funkcji FeedRate (zmiana prędkości na 30% ustawionej):
CurrentFeedrate = FeedRate()
SetFeedRate(CurrentFeedrate*0.30)

Nie miałem wcześniej styczności z G-Code i Mach-em dlatego nie wiem, czy nastawa stałej prędkości będzie pobierana przez makro i mach wykona powyższe obliczenie?

Ogólna idea jest taka, że maszyna tnie z ustaloną w machu prędkością i jak dojeżdża do wyznaczonego puntu zostaje wywołane makro zmiany prędkości cięcia po czym następuje dalsze cięcie i znów wywołanie makra z powrotem do maksymalnej ustalonej prędkości cięcia. Czy to w ogóle ma prawo tak zadziałać?



Tagi:

Awatar użytkownika

k-m-r1
ELITA FORUM (min. 1000)
ELITA FORUM (min. 1000)
Posty w temacie: 1
Posty: 1417
Rejestracja: 23 cze 2008, 10:38
Lokalizacja: OOL lub DW
Kontakt:

#2

Post napisał: k-m-r1 » 31 mar 2011, 00:08

ale po co sięawic skoro można to w g code zapisac
[b]MACH3 cnc[/b]Tworzenie Makr do palników magazynków THC OHC inne[b]EKRANY dla firm producentów maszyn[/b] Budowa sprzedaż wypalarki plazma gaz obrotnice Elektrodrążarki Frezarki Tokarki Giętarki3D inne wg zlecenia 888 708 196 Tomek Komor [email protected]


Autor tematu
modrzej
Nowy użytkownik, używaj wyszukiwarki
Nowy użytkownik, używaj wyszukiwarki
Posty w temacie: 3
Posty: 3
Rejestracja: 30 mar 2011, 22:51
Lokalizacja: łódź

#3

Post napisał: modrzej » 31 mar 2011, 00:36

No ok ale w jaki sposób?
Wrykrys i Mach jedzie na gcode i mcode. I w wrykrysie nie ma przy preprocesorze macha możliwości zmiany prędkości przesuwu dlatego chcemy napisac makro które będzie się wykonywało wtedy kiedy będzie to potrzebne.
Ogólnie rzecz biorąc zostałem poproszony o dopisanie czegoś takiego... z praktycznego punktu widzenia nie mam zielonego pojęcia jak to się zachowuje. Dlatego szukam pomocy... bo kto pyta nie błądzi tak ?


nerc
Sympatyk forum poziom 1 (min. 40)
Sympatyk forum poziom 1 (min. 40)
Posty w temacie: 2
Posty: 46
Rejestracja: 06 lis 2008, 13:07
Lokalizacja: Polska
Kontakt:

#4

Post napisał: nerc » 01 kwie 2011, 09:23

Może ja wyjaśnię o co koledzie Modrzejowi dokładnie chodzi:

Mamy program do generowania ścieżki Wrykrys, w nim chciałbym nie podawać odpowiednich wartości liczbowych posuwu tylko wartości procentowe dla danej linii.
Natomiast w Machu chciałbym ustawić prędkości maksymalną np F1000 i aby Mach sam wiedział jaką prędkość ma zastosować na danym odcinku.

Będziemy dopiero testować makra, ale boję się że podczas ruchu maszynai zatrzyma się wywoła makro i dalej ruszy, a nam chodzi o płynną zmianę. Może można by użyć do tego zastosowania PLC MACHA (Brain)??


Autor tematu
modrzej
Nowy użytkownik, używaj wyszukiwarki
Nowy użytkownik, używaj wyszukiwarki
Posty w temacie: 3
Posty: 3
Rejestracja: 30 mar 2011, 22:51
Lokalizacja: łódź

#5

Post napisał: modrzej » 01 kwie 2011, 19:34

nerc, no właśnie to chciałem powiedzieć... wczoraj też myśleliśmy nad barinem, ale ni cholery nie wiem jak się za niego zabrać...
I tak narazie nie mam jak potestować bo maszyna stoi (muszą zniwelować luzy na posuwie).


nerc
Sympatyk forum poziom 1 (min. 40)
Sympatyk forum poziom 1 (min. 40)
Posty w temacie: 2
Posty: 46
Rejestracja: 06 lis 2008, 13:07
Lokalizacja: Polska
Kontakt:

#6

Post napisał: nerc » 01 kwie 2011, 21:00

(muszą zniwelować luzy na posuwie).
Luzy zniwelowane :) prawie już tniemy kółka :D na razie mamy niedokładność, mierzoną mikroskopem 0.09mm na detalu 100x100 w środku okrąg 20mm, na kwadracie jest 0,02mm niedokładności.

Proszę o pomoc w sprawie: makra, pluginu, brainu.....

Awatar użytkownika

andmar2005
Specjalista poziom 1 (min. 100)
Specjalista poziom 1 (min. 100)
Posty w temacie: 1
Posty: 190
Rejestracja: 15 sie 2009, 08:55
Lokalizacja: kujawsko-pomorski
Kontakt:

#7

Post napisał: andmar2005 » 27 kwie 2011, 22:23

hi
zobaczcie ten program
współpracuje z machem SheetCam TNG w tle masz włączonego macha, zrobisz ścieżkę ciecie generacja g-kodu i masz już to w machu- taka mała wygoda

http://www.sheetcam.com/downloads.shtml

https://www.cnc.info.pl/topics44/progra ... 402,10.htm

ODPOWIEDZ Poprzedni tematNastępny temat

Wróć do „G-CODE - programowanie”